#B24F18 Hex Color Code

#B24F18

The Hexadecimal Color #B24F18 is a contrast shade of Sienna. #B24F18 RGB value is rgb(178, 79, 24). RGB Color Model of #B24F18 consists of 69% red, 30% green and 9% blue. HSL color Mode of #B24F18 has 21°(degrees) Hue, 76% Saturation and 40% Lightness. #B24F18 color has an wavelength of 606.77778n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#B24F18 is #CC6633.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#B24F18 is #A51. The Closest Color to #B24F18 is #A0522D. Official Name of #B24F18 Hex Code is Fiery Orange.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#B24F18 is 0 Cyan 56 Magenta 87 Yellow 30 Black and #B24F18 CMY is 0, 56, 87.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#B24F18 is hsl(21,76,40,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(21, 87, 70).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#B24F18 is 21.32, 15.13, 2.66.
Hex8 Value of #B24F18 is #B24F18FF. Decimal Value of #B24F18 is 11685656 and Octal Value of #B24F18 is 54447430. Binary Value of #B24F18 is 10110010, 1001111, 11000 and Android of #B24F18 is 4289875736 / 0xffb24f18.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#B24F18 is 0.545, 0.387, 0.387 and YIQ Color Space of #B24F18 is 102.331, 76.6656, 3.8225.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#B24F18 is 21.69, 10.7, 2.89.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#B24F18 is 45.81, 37.37, 48.54.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#B24F18 is 45.81, 80.38, 37.55.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#B24F18 is 45.81, 61.26, 52.41. Hunter Lab variable of #B24F18 is 38.9, 29.77, 23.17.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#B24F18

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
